Samsung is determined to rival Apple in the Tablets market as they have planned next generation Galaxy Tabs for next year. At IFA 2010, Head of Samsung Product Planning has revealed the next platfrom upgrade for Galaxy Tab would be Android 3.0 GingerBread

The next platform we’ll be using [on the Galaxy Tab] will be Gingerbread. Depending on our international partners, we’ll be working to upgrade from Froyo to Gingerbread.
For next generation Galaxy Tab, the platform to be used is Android 3.5 codenamed HoneyComb. He further reveals why to go for Android 3.5 Honey Comb.
Moving forward, with Honeycomb, that will be used in the next generation tablet, as it [Honeycomb] is specifically optimised for different type of tablet, and will be used on another product only
It was already being suspected that Android 3.5 HoneyComb will be tailored for Tablets which may imply the there will be no Android 3.5 Phones.
